Everence Capital Management's Q3 2014 Portfolio in Review

As of Q3 2014, Everence Capital Management held 279 positions worth $274M, up 1.6% from $270M the previous quarter. Its ten largest holdings account for 19% of the portfolio.

Everence Capital Management's Q3 2014 filing shows 8 new, 6 increased, 17 reduced and 7 closed positions. Its largest new stake was Discovery, Inc. Series C Common Stock: 6,791 shares worth $292K. The largest sale was Valero Energy, an estimated $524K.

By sector, the portfolio is most concentrated in Technology at 17% of assets, up from 17% a quarter earlier, followed by Financials and Healthcare.
